			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Today I&#8217;m joining <a href="www.lifeasmom.com">Frugal Friday</a>.</p>
<p>One way I try to be frugal is to take basic ingredients and keep them stocked in my pantry.  Then I try to use them in various forms.  For example, I do not know anyone who eats cream of mushroom soup as a soup, rather it goes into casseroles.  This year I want to learn to do the same think with condensed tomato soup.  Now is a good time to start.  It is soup season and you can get decent deals on condensed soups.  I usually buy a years worth of soups this time of year.  However, I always end up with leftover condensed tomato soup.  I use my cream of mushroom and chicken, but have not gotten creative with the tomato.  I did some research this year and found a few recipes.  I&#8217;ve not tried these but wanted to get a game plan before I brought in 100 cans.</p>

<p>Here are a few ideas with my comments:</p>
<p>I am going to try this in my bread.  I&#8217;ve made herb bread using v8, but the next round I will use tomato soup instead of water.  I&#8217;ll add herbs and hope it is great.  I quickly searched the internet and did not find any similar that I wanted to try.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.vanillagarlic.com/2006/10/tomato-soup-cupcakes-with-cream-cheese.html">Tomato soup cupcakes with cream cheese frosting</a>:  It sounds yucky but I read on and it looks like a spice cake.  I think this is one worth trying.  At least it is very creative.</p>
<p><a href="http://allrecipes.com/Recipe/Marinated-Carrot-Salad/Detail.aspx">Marinated Carrot Salad</a>:  again I thought yuck, but there were 9 reviews that were very complimentary.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.adrianbruce.com/morntea/tomato_&amp;_crab_soup.htm">Tomato soup meatloaf: </a> I use 1/2 a jar of spaghetti sauce in my meatloaf now.  I could use a can of soup instead and not have the half jar leftover.</p>
<p><a href="http://busycooks.about.com/od/groundbeefrecipes/r/goulash.htm">Oldfashioned Goulash</a>:  If I make this I&#8217;ll have to remain it.  Dave won&#8217;t eat anything called &#8220;goulash.&#8221;</p>
<p><a href="http://allrecipes.com/Recipe/Tomato-Soup-Cake-I/Detail.aspx">Tomato Soup Cake:</a> this one had a ton of good review.  Where have I been?  I&#8217;ve never heard of using tomato soup in cake!</p>
<p><a href="http://www.cdkitchen.com/recipes/recs/475/Barbequed_Spareribs55353.shtml">BBQ Spareribs</a>:  I think we&#8217;d like this one.  It looks like it would work in the crockpot too.</p>
<p><a href="http://mommysavers.com/boards/soups-stews/47735-chili-recipe-using-tomato-soup.html">Chili:</a> last time I made chili I used a couple of cans of manwich.  But using tomato soup might be good too.</p>
<p><a href="http://mommysavers.com/boards/soups-stews/47735-chili-recipe-using-tomato-soup.html">Zesty Tomato Pork Chops</a>:  I would have never tried this, but looks good.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.adrianbruce.com/morntea/tomato_&amp;_crab_soup.htm">Crab and Tomato Soup</a>:  I have several cans of crab I got on sale at Walgreens.  So all I need for this recipe is cream and homemade bread.  I wonder if I could use vit D evap milk I got for free at Krogers instead of cream?  I bet it would work.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>While I was recovering from surgery last Friday, I watched several videos.  One was <a href="http://www.visionforum.com/search/productdetail.aspx?search=return&amp;productid=67850">Return of the Daughters.</a> I highly recommend this video.   My friend told me it might challenge me because it gives a path for our young adult daughters that is counter cultural.  Since I spent 16 plus years in the workforce, many would think I would be shocked by this video.  But the reverse it true.  I think, especially now, we are in an age where daughters need to be protected from the world <span style="text-decoration:underline;">and</span> prepared for the world.  I am questioning the wisdom of sending our daughters away to college at age 18.  I&#8217;ve been thinking this for a while, but this video pretty much summarized my position.</p>
<p>The key is preparing our daughters for the world while they are at home &#8211; not making them weak naive young women who haven&#8217;t a clue of the world.  I have a doctorate degree, so &#8216;degrees&#8217; are important to me.  However, we&#8217;ve become a society that loves &#8216;degrees&#8217; but not necessarily education.  What does education really mean?   I am a lawyer, but am learning much more about our constitution and country&#8217;s founding in homeschooling than I did in law school.  So degrees do not equal education.  Degrees do not teach you to think.  They do, however, open doors and are still important.</p>
<p>We are trying to balance life learning with formal education.  We push the girls with academics, but want to push only to their capabilities.  And at home I want to push them to think about life.  For example, if you asked my two older girls for a decent price for fresh corn on the cob at the grocery store, they could tell you.  Recently they went to a nursing home with my mom&#8217;s church group and they were able to interact with the elderly.  Bethany even played the piano for the group.    Children having the ability to socialize with generations away from theirs is a needed skill in our day and age.   I want them to see the value in serving others and having good manners.</p>
<p>The hard part is not sheltering them so much that they become naive.  We have chosen to allow Bethany to read books that many in our circle would disapprove.  If she asks me a question about life, I give her a very real answer.  For example, she has noticed some of the Houston billboards for the clubs.   Since she asked, I explained exactly what goes on in these establishments.   Finding a balance with protection and preparation is a fine line and one that each family must determine.   If you&#8217;ve read my blog for long, you know I have extremely conservative tendencies.  However, we are surprisingly liberal in several areas in which I think religious society has set taboos not set by God.</p>
<p>We are far far far from perfect.  But this is the age to be counter cultural.  When you go down the road less traveled, you make mistakes.  But you don&#8217;t have to be perfect to change the world.  Just willing.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>I used to be a food network junkie.  I recorded several shows and really enjoyed watching wonderful meals be prepared.  The last couple of years, however, I&#8217;ve almost stopped.  Looking back it was not a conscious decision but an evolution.  Either they changed or I changed.  I&#8217;m not sure and will let you be the judge.</p>
<p>I think a few years ago, I came away with more practical ideas.  Now it seems many of the shows have ingredients that are not in the frugal kitchen.  And they seem to constantly stress using quality ingredients.  How many times did I hear, use</p>
<ul>
<li>high quality extra extra extra virgin oil (real life &#8211; only evo if you can taste it)</li>
<li>imported such / in / such cheese (real life:  kraft cheese you got with a coupon.)</li>
<li>a rustic bread from your baker (real life:  If you get bread with oats on top, you splurged)</li>
<li>organic meats (real life:  you shop at 9:30 when the clearance meat is out in abundance)</li>
<li>wild salmon &#8211; not farm raised (real life:  you rarely buy Salmon b/c it is over $2 a pound &#8211; catfish is the fish of choice)</li>
<li>fancy greens (like arugula) &#8211; (real life &#8211; your grocery store only sells romaine, butter, green &amp; red leaf and iceburg)</li>
<li>creme fresh instead of sour cream (real life &#8211; even I have never purchased creme fresh)</li>
<li>fresh herbs (real life &#8211; only if you get them from your back yard)</li>
<li>special salt from such / such sea (real life &#8211; special salt is mortons over the generic brand)</li>
<li>real organic butter &#8211; (real life &#8211; a box 79 cent imperial margarine for baking and real butter saved for spreading on bread)</li>
<li>eggs that you picked up from an organic farm (real life:  what ever is cheapest at the grocery store)</li>
<li>chocolate imported from mars (real life:  getting nestle choc chips instead of the store brand )</li>
</ul>
<p>If you&#8217;ve watched this network for long, then you know what I&#8221;m talking about.  One time I watched one of the guy chefs (not bobby flay but the one that looks like him)  make chicken broth.  He roasted an organic chicken, then boiled it.  After he was finished, he tossed the chicken.   I was yelling at the TV like guys do when watching a football game.   I do not know anyone who uses a whole chicken to make broth and then tosses the meat.  We roast a chicken, eat the chicken and then boil the bones for broth.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ve also noticed a political theme starting to run in their shows.  I have not enjoyed a Paula Deen show after she had on Jimmy Carter.  I have no problem watching a cooking show with a past President.  I&#8217;d even watch one with Michele and Obamma.  I respect the office.  But when Paula started drooling and expressing what a great man and how he had done wonderful things&#8230; again I&#8217;m yelling at the TV.  If I want to watch political spin, I&#8217;ll turn to CNN.</p>
<p>Then we have the social agenda.  I don&#8217;t mind watching non-traditonal family folks celebrating life together.  Some of my favorite neighbors choose lifestyles that don&#8217;t line up with mine.  That doesn&#8217;t mean I don&#8217;t love hanging out with them.   What I do hate is when it is put in a TV show with a social agenda.  When I watch Barefoot Contessa, it doesn&#8217;t bother me because she has a couple of guys over.  If my kids are in the room, it is not something that draws their attention.  However, their cake decorating show did a wedding cake.  The girls love making cakes so we were watching this.  And wouldn&#8217;t you know, it was two girls getting married.</p>
<p>Another reason I watched was for the quick fix and make ahead shows.  I really like Robin Miller.  But them more I watched, the more I saw how expensive it was to make these dishes.  For example, when she makes shrimp &#8211; it is jumbo shrimp prepared by the fish shop.  When I make shrimp, I got it at a rock bottom price which means it is smaller, with shell and frozen.  I have to defrost and prepare the shrimp.  So it is not a quick fix without the extra cost.  Quick fix can be really easy when you have no budget.</p>
<p>And let&#8217;s talk about cleavage for a minute.  I don&#8217;t watch a cooking show to see Giada&#8217;s breasts.  It grosses me out.  When ever she turns on a blender they zoom right into where she flips on the blender switch, which is about right around her chest area.  Yes, I know this is an accident.  I love her recipes, but am over the skimpy shirts that go down to her naval.</p>
<p>And I used to love Nagela Lawson.  This past weekend I watched her making chocolate dishes.  With all my bags of chocolate from the Kroger Mega Sale, I curled up ready to be educated on wonderful chocolate dishes.  The whole show was sexual innuendos.  It was over the top.  It was so distracting from what I was there to learn.  I love her accent and her cooking, but I don&#8217;t know if I can watch her again.</p>
<p>I wish there was a really good show that used frugal ingredients and stuck with cooking.  Food can be entertaining on its own &#8211; we don&#8217;t need the extra stuff.  But what they&#8217;re doing must drive up ratings.  Maybe I&#8217;ll start youtube videos one day.  Cooking with Kris.  We&#8217;d have to learn how to use our video camera first &#8211; now that is a whole store in itself.</p>
